SA 0.7.8
I am getting some strange results when using a subquery that returns 
 Duplicate
rows.  Note in line 7 I am not using distinct, yet I get one object where I 
would expect
2.  Also if I  query.count I do actually receive 2.  
What's going on here?

Thanks,
kris

vq1 = DBSession.query(Value).filter_by(document_id = 622849) 

In [3]: vq1.all()
Out[3]: 
[<bq.data_service.model.tag_model.Value object at 0x59a2890>,
 <bq.data_service.model.tag_model.Value object at 0x59a2990>]

In [5]: sq1 = vq1.with_labels().subquery()
In [6]: q = DBSession.query (Taggable).filter (Taggable.id == 
sq1.c.values_valobj)

In [7]: q.all()
Out[7]: [<bq.data_service.model.tag_model.Taggable object at 0x59b0590>]

In [9]: q.count()
Out[9]: 2L

>From sql:

select * from values where resource_parent_id = 622849;
 resource_parent_id | indx | valstr | valnum | valobj | document_id 
--------------------+------+--------+--------+--------+-------------
             622849 |    0 |        |        | 622840 |      622849
             622849 |    1 |        |        | 622840 |      622849


=# select id  from taggable, (select * from values where document_id = 
622849) as v where taggable.id = v.valobj;
   id   
--------
 622840
 622840
